well the gf's car has started bucking again. i knew something wasn't right last week when her remote starter wasn't cranking enough to get the car started. it does run better htan before, but the start sounds rough, and she's never had issues with the crank time on the remote starter before. (yeah i dind't get around to changing the plugs). rather than change them, i'm just gonna go back to the dealer with her, she paid good money for the work, and they should be the ones to fix it.

my guess is that they replaced the one plug, and didn't bother checking which type was in there (so she'd have 1 motorcraft and 3 of whatever midas threw in there). if not, then the issue would seem to be coil or wires (which they should have checked when troubleshooting anyway).
